Banfield Foundation Disaster Relief
Emergency Funding for Animal Welfare Organizations Responding to Disasters
The Banfield Foundation Disaster Relief Grant Program provides emergency funding to nonprofit animal welfare organizations and eligible government animal service agencies responding to natural or other unanticipated disasters. These grants help ensure pets receive immediate care, shelter, and essential services when communities are impacted by crisis.
The Banfield Foundation prioritizes immediate disaster response and relief, recognizing that emergencies are not a matter of if, but when. Applications are accepted on a rolling basis to support rapid response needs.

What This Program Supports
Disaster Relief Grant funds may be used for immediate, disaster-related needs, including:
- Veterinary care and medical supplies for affected pets
- Pet food and essential pet supplies (crates, bedding, etc.)
- Temporary sheltering or boarding for rescued or at-risk animals
- Cleaning supplies, tarps, blankets, and other emergency materials
- Transportation costs to rescue, evacuate, or relocate pets
- Disaster-related operational costs such as overtime staffing, rental facilities or equipment, and cleanup expenses
💡 Eligible expenses may be reimbursed for up to three months post-disaster.
Eligibility Requirements
Applicants must:
- Be a nonprofit animal welfare organization with 501(c)(3) status or a local or state government animal service agency
- Have an animal welfare mission or a direct relationship with an animal welfare organization
- Have been directly impacted by a recent disaster and/or be providing assistance in a disaster-affected area
- Operate programs serving pets and their owners in the United States
Ineligible Requests
The Banfield Foundation does not fund:
- Requests related to the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ic
- Hoarding or abuse cases
- Feral animal population programs
- Programs solely dedicated to sanctuary animals, equine, livestock, or wildlife assistance
Funding Amounts
Grant amounts are not publicly disclosed and vary based on disaster scope, urgency, demonstrated need, and available funding.

Application Process
Organizations must submit an online Disaster Relief Grant application describing:
- The disaster or emergency situation
- How the organization has been affected or is providing assistance
- How grant funds will be used to support immediate relief efforts
